一种网上支付验证的方法和设备的制造方法

文档序号:9472097阅读:203来源:国知局
一种网上支付验证的方法和设备的制造方法
【技术领域】
[0001]本申请实施例涉及网络信息处理技术,特别涉及一种网上支付验证的方法和相关设备。
【背景技术】
[0002]随着互联网上提供了越来越多的网络交易,网上支付方式已经成为人们日常生活中的一种重要支付方式。例如,在网购、网上理财的时候,一般都需要用户通过网络操作来实现资金从一个账户支付给另一个账户的网上支付过程。为了保证用户的账户资金在互联网上处于安全的状态,通常在网上支付过程中需要对用户发起的支付请求进行验证,以确定该支付请求是否为恶意发起的风险交易,从而避免风险交易造成用户损失账户资金。
[0003]目前,较为常见的网上支付验证方式大多是基于表示用户身份的信息(如账号)与密码间的对应关系来验证支付请求的。例如,一种现有的网上支付验证方式中,用户在请求网上支付时需要输入自己的账号和密码,网上支付系统验证该密码与预先为该账号设置的密码是否相同,如果相同则执行此次网上支付。此时,通过密码对网上支付请求的验证,可以避免用户账户的资金被盗用。
[0004]但是,在用户的终端设备中毒等情况下,用户的账号和密码会被恶意盗取,这就会使得现有的网上支付验证方式不能识别出用户的账户资金被盗用的风险交易,从而导致用户账户资金不再安全。更为重要的是,随着网上支付方式越来越广泛地应用到移动终端上,用户的账号与密码通常都预置在其移动终端上,而用户的移动终端一旦被盗,也将导致用户的账号和密码被恶意盗取,从而使得现有的网上支付验证方式无法识别风险交易,影响用户账户资金的安全性。

【发明内容】

[0005]本申请实施例所要解决的技术问题是,提供一种网上支付验证的方法和设备,以解决按照现有技术中在用户身份信息与密码被恶意盗取的情况下难以避免风险交易影响用户账户资金安全性的问题。
[0006]为解决上述技术问题,本申请实施例提供了一种网上支付验证的方法,该方法包括:
[0007]响应于第一用户的网上支付操作,接收所述第一用户的支付请求;
[0008]查找预先为所述第一用户记录的验证确认用户作为第二用户,并向所述第二用户发送支付确认请求;
[0009]响应于所述第二用户对所述支付确认请求的确认操作,接收所述第二用户的确认支付消息,并执行所述支付请求的网上支付。
[0010]可选的,该方法还包括:
[0011]响应于所述第一用户将所述第二用户设置为验证确认用户的操作,接收所述第一用户的设置请求;
[0012]基于所述设置请求,向所述第二用户发送设置确认请求;
[0013]响应于所述第二用户对所述设置确认请求的确认操作,接收所述第二用户的确认设置消息,并将所述第二用户记录为所述第一用户的验证确认用户。
[0014]可选的,该方法还包括:
[0015]响应于所述第一用户取消所述第二用户作为验证确认用户的操作,接收所述第一用户的设置取消请求;
[0016]基于所述设置取消请求,向所述第二用户发送设置取消确认请求;
[0017]响应于所述第二用户对所述设置取消确认请求的确认操作,接收所述第二用户的确认设置取消消息,并删除所述第二用户作为所述第一用户的验证确认用户的记录。
[0018]可选的,该方法还包括:
[0019]响应于接收所述第一用户的支付请求,计算所述第一用户的累计支付金额;
[0020]判断所述第一用户的累计支付金额是否超过预先为所述第一用户记录的阈值金额;
[0021]如果是,进入执行所述查找预先为所述第一用户记录的验证确认用户作为第二用户。
[0022]可选的,该方法还包括;
[0023]响应于所述第二用户对所述支付确认请求的取消操作,接收所述第二用户的取消支付消息,并拒绝所述支付请求的网上支付。
[0024]可选的,该方法还包括:
[0025]响应于向所述第二用户发送支付确认请求之后的预置时间段内未接收到所述第二用户的反馈,拒绝所述支付请求的网上支付。
[0026]此外,本申请实施例还提供了一种网上支付验证的设备,该设备包括:
[0027]支付请求接收模块,用于响应于第一用户的网上支付操作,接收所述第一用户的支付请求;
[0028]确认用户查找模块,用于查找预先为所述第一用户记录的验证确认用户作为第二用户;
[0029]支付确认请求发送模块,用于向所述第二用户发送支付确认请求;
[0030]网上支付执行模块,用于响应于所述第二用户对所述支付确认请求的确认操作,接收所述第二用户的确认支付消息,并执行所述支付请求的网上支付。
[0031]可选的,该设备还包括:
[0032]设置请求接收模块,用于响应于所述第一用户将所述第二用户设置为验证确认用户的操作,接收所述第一用户的设置请求;
[0033]设置确认请求发送模块,用于基于所述设置请求,向所述第二用户发送设置确认请求;
[0034]确认用户记录模块,用于响应于所述第二用户对所述设置确认请求的认操作,接收所述第二用户的确认设置消息,并将所述第二用户记录为所述第一用户的验证确认用户。
[0035]可选的,该设备还包括:
[0036]取消请求接收模块,用于响应于所述第一用户取消所述第二用户作为验证确认用户的操作,接收所述第一用户的设置取消请求;
[0037]取消确认请求发送模块,用于基于所述设置取消请求,向所述第二用户发送设置取消确认请求;
[0038]确认用户记录删除模块,用于响应于所述第二用户对所述设置取消确认请求的确认操作,接收所述第二用户的确认设置取消消息,并删除所述第二用户作为所述第一用户的验证确认用户的记录。
[0039]可选的,该设备还包括:
[0040]累计支付计算模块,用于响应于接收所述第一用户的支付请求,计算所述第一用户的累计支付金额;
[0041]累计支付判断模块,用于判断所述第一用户的累计支付金额是否超过预先为所述第一用户记录的阈值金额;
[0042]确认用户查找触发模块,用于在所述累计支付判断模块的判断结果为是的情况下,触发所述确认用户查找模块。
[0043]可选的,该设备还包括:
[0044]第一网上支付拒绝模块,用于响应于所述第二用户对所述支付确认请求的取消操作,接收所述第二用户的取消支付消息,并拒绝所述支付请求的网上支付。
[0045]可选的,该设备还包括:
[0046]第二网上支付拒绝模块,用于响应于向所述第二用户发送支付确认请求之后的预置时间段内未接收到所述第二用户的反馈,拒绝所述支付请求的网上支付。
[0047]与现有技术相比,本申请具有以下优点:
[0048]根据本申请实施例的技术方案,用户可以为其网上支付预先设置验证确认用户,系统则可以预先记录下该用户所设置的验证确认用户,而当接收到该用户的支付请求时,可以向为该用户预先记录的验证确认用户发送支付确认请求,并基于该验证确认用户的反馈,当接收到确认支付消息时再执行该支付请求的网上支付。因此,当用户发起网上支付的支付请求时,由于该支付请求的网上支付是否执行是由该用户预先设置的验证确认用户自主去验证确定的,所以,即使该用户的用户身份信息和密码被恶意盗取,恶意发起风险交易的网上支付也可以被该用户的验证确认用户取消,从而使得在用户身份信息与密码被恶意盗取的情况下风险交易的网上支付无法执行,使得用户账户的资金更加安全。
【附图说明】
[0049]为了更清楚地说明本申请实施例或现有技术中的技术方案,下面将对实施例或现有技术描述中所需要使用的附图作简单地介绍,显而易见地,下面描述中的附图仅仅是本申请中记载的一些实施例,对于本领域普通技术人员来讲,在不付出创造性劳动的前提下,还可以根据这些附图获得其他的附图。
[0050]图1为本申请实施例中一个示例性应用场景的框架示意图;
[0051]图2为本申请中网上支付验证的方法实施例1的流程图;
[0052]图3为本申请实施例中设置验证确
当前第1页1 2 3 4 5 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1